Mehru Öztürk

Mehru Öztürk has over 26 years of experience in the civil society sector and is the General Manager and a founding trustee of the Turkish Entrepreneurship Foundation. She is also on the committee of Founder One, Turkey’s first impact investment fund, and co-founded The Good Factor, a company focused on transforming brands into agents of social change.

She is a founding trustee of Community Volunteers Foundation (TOG) and co-founded the Things project with Techsoup Europe to promote social innovation through technology. Mehru serves on various councils and initiatives, including:

  • Council of Women Entrepreneurship, Ministry of Technology and Industry of Türkiye
  • Council of Techno-Ventures, Ministry of Technology and Industry of Türkiye
  • European Women in VC
  • Leaders for Climate Change
  • EIT Food Council
  • UN & ITU AI For Good Initiative

Previously, she worked for the EU TACSO project, helping organize Turkey’s first International Social Entrepreneurship Conference and developing social entrepreneurship programs. Today, she continues to mentor and advise in national and international entrepreneurship initiatives, driven by her passion for innovation, youth empowerment, and social impact.
